Abstract
Vascular malformation is a rare cause of bleeding from the lower gastrointestinal tract. We present a case of 16-year-old patient with a hemorrhage from the gastrointestinal tract, which led to the life-threatening anemia. Gastroduodenoscopy and colonoscopy were performed and did not locate a bleeding site. Consecutively, an exploratory laparotomy did not locate the pathology either. A bleeding site was visualized by computed tomography angiography (CTA) of the abdomen. Relaparotomy was performed and the 4-centimeter part of the intestine and a small jejunal vascular malformation were histopathologically revealed.
